Yes it is possible, I know that Intrushield from McAfee can do this if
provided the keys. Although it might only be ssl traffic. This will
also increase the load on the actual device by a nice amount, so keep
that in mind. Maybe someone else can plug in any other device they
know that is currently doing this.
